Lindorff-Ellery, Evan / Naomi Juniper: Studio, Creek [CASSETTE W/ DOWNLOAD] (Disseminated Light And Sound Recordings)

Recorded outdoors along Stony Kill Creek in Wawarsing and in a Mt Tremper studio, Evan Lindorff-Ellery and Naomi Juniper blend acoustic guitar, voice and glass jar with electric guitar, piano and activated objects into intimate yet friction-laced improvisations that merge environmental presence with tactile surface work, balancing fragile song-forms against raw, textural interplay.

Artist Biographies

Naomi Juniper is a vocalist and acoustic guitarist working at the intersection of song, improvisation and sound-based exploration. Her practice often centers on close listening and site-responsive performance, integrating environmental sound, extended vocal techniques and unconventional resonant objects — such as glass vessels — into her work.

Rather than adhering strictly to folk or experimental traditions, Juniper moves between them, allowing fragments of melody and lyricism to surface within open-form structures. Her approach favors intimacy and immediacy: the grain of the voice, the physicality of strings, and the subtle acoustics of place are treated as compositional elements in themselves.

Evan Lindorff-Ellery is based in Kingston, New York. He runs the contemporary/experimental music record label, Notice Recordings. In addition to art-making and running Notice, hs is also a gardener, landscaper, and tree worker. He is concerned with organic and permaculture-style approaches.
